首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用EntityFramework高效地统计表格中存在的项的数量?

EntityFramework是一个面向对象的数据库访问技术,它提供了一种简化和高效的方式来操作数据库。使用EntityFramework可以轻松地进行数据查询、插入、更新和删除等操作。

要高效地统计表格中存在的项的数量,可以使用EntityFramework提供的LINQ查询语法。以下是一个示例代码:

代码语言:txt
复制
using System;
using System.Linq;

// 创建一个DbContext类,表示数据库上下文
public class MyDbContext : DbContext
{
    public DbSet<MyEntity> MyEntities { get; set; }
}

// 创建一个实体类,表示数据库中的表格
public class MyEntity
{
    public int Id { get; set; }
    public string Name { get; set; }
}

class Program
{
    static void Main(string[] args)
    {
        using (var context = new MyDbContext())
        {
            // 统计表格中存在的项的数量
            int count = context.MyEntities.Count();
            Console.WriteLine("表格中存在的项的数量为:" + count);
        }
    }
}

在上述代码中,首先需要创建一个继承自DbContext的数据库上下文类(MyDbContext),并在该类中定义一个DbSet属性,表示数据库中的表格(MyEntities)。然后创建一个实体类(MyEntity),表示表格中的每一行数据。

在Main方法中,通过创建MyDbContext的实例,可以访问数据库并进行操作。使用context.MyEntities.Count()可以获取表格中存在的项的数量,并将结果打印输出。

这里推荐使用腾讯云的云数据库MySQL作为数据库服务,它提供了高可用、高性能、弹性扩展的特点,适用于各种规模的应用场景。具体产品介绍和链接地址请参考腾讯云官方文档:云数据库MySQL

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券